    In 1937 the CCP Central Revolutionary Military Commission [b] was created after the Chinese Soviet Republic's Chinese Red Army were integrated into the Kuomintang's army for the anti-Japanese war, and it later evolved into the Central Military Commission after the 7th National Congress of the Chinese Communist Party in 1945.

    It was established on 11 January 2016, under the military reforms of Central Military Commission (CMC) chairman Xi Jinping. [ 2 ] Headquartered in Beijing, the Joint Staff Department (JSD) is under the absolute leadership of the CMC and likely serves as an institutional link between members of the CMC and post-2016 PLA theater commands .
